The Parliamentary Committee for the Political System, Judiciary and Administration has decided that tomorrow, December 30, 2022, it will announce a public call for the election of three members of the Judicial Council from among distinguished lawyers.

This is the second invitation of the parent Board this year, after the Assembly on September 20 elected only Radoj Korać as a member of the Judicial Council from the quota of distinguished lawyers.

As written in the decision of the Board, which is signed by President Momo Koprivica, a person who meets the conditions prescribed by Article 16 paragraph 1 of the Law on the Judicial Council and Judges can be elected as a member of the Judicial Council from among distinguished lawyers.

"That he has fifteen years of work experience in legal affairs, enjoys personal and professional reputation and that he has not been convicted of criminal acts that make judges unworthy to perform judicial functions in accordance with the Law," the invitation states.

Applications for the Public Call with documentation are submitted in a sealed envelope to the Assembly's office or by mail, and the deadline for registering candidates is 15 days from the date of the public call. In accordance with the Law on the Judicial Council and Judges, the list of registered candidates will be published on the website of the Assembly and will be available to the public for at least ten days from the date of publication.

At the end of May of this year, the Committee for Political System, Judiciary and Public Administration announced a public call for the election of four distinguished lawyers in the SS, and as many as 35 candidates applied for that call.

During the summer, the board held several days of consultative hearings, and by the decision of the members, four candidates were chosen - professor Korać, lawyer from Bijelo Polje Fikret Kurgaš, lawyer Dragan Šoć and professor of the Faculty of Law Nebojsa Vučinić.

That the selection of members of the SS, even before the announcement of the public invitation, was a matter of political trade, was clear even before the Parliamentary Committee issued a public advertisement when "Vijesti" announced that professors Korać and Vučinić as well as lawyer Šoć were the most serious candidates for filling that position. bodies from the ranks of distinguished lawyers.

After that election failed, the competent working body, in accordance with Article 16a of the Law on the Judicial Council and Judges, was obliged to announce a new public invitation after the expiration of two months, until the full selection of the members of the Judicial Council from among distinguished lawyers.

In the Judicial Council, the 3rd mandate is now largely spent by three distinguished lawyers - president Vesna Simović Zvicer, Dobrica Šljivančanin and Loro Markić, who were elected to these positions in 2014, but after the legal change in 2018, they are allowed to hold that position all the time. until the election of new members of the Judicial Council from among distinguished lawyers.
